The experiments of Michael Faraday in England and Joseph Henry in USA, conducted around 1830, demonstrated conclusively that electric currents were induced in closed coils when subjected to changing magnetic fields. Today Faraday is recognized as the discoverer of mutual inductance (the basis of transformers), while Henry is credited with the discovery of self-inductance. During his experiments with electromagnetism, Henry discovered the property of inductance in electrical circuits, which was first recognized at about the same time in England by Michael Faraday, who was the first to publish on the subject.
